The angular momentum of a particle with respect to the origin will not zero, if

A

the directional lone of linear momentum passes through the origin

B

the particle is the origin

C

the angle between the position vector and linear momentum is 180°

D

the linear momentum vanishes

E

the angle between the position vector and linear momentum is 90°

Answer

the angle between the position vector and linear momentum is 90°

Explanation

Solution

The correct option is (E) : the angle between the position vector and linear momentum is 90°
